Mite Infestation in Green-Cheeked Conures

Knemidokoptic mange shows up far less often in this Pyrrhura species than it does in budgerigars, and because a green-cheek's quiet, low-drama temperament means it rarely broadcasts a problem loudly, a keeper's own routine beak-and-foot glances during handling do most of the early-catching work here.

Possible causes

  • A dormant Knemidokoptes population — present at low levels in a share of otherwise healthy birds — breaking cover once something else knocks the immune system off balance
  • Direct skin contact with a second conure, most often a cage-mate or aviary companion, that's actively shedding the mite
  • A drop in condition tied to age, an unrelated illness, or a rough stretch of stress that leaves the bird less able to suppress a background parasite load
  • A thin, low-variety diet that under-supports the immune system relative to a nutritionally complete one
  • Humid, densely planted outdoor flight or aviary housing, which this forest-native species tolerates well overall but which can also extend a mite's window of viability between hosts

What to do

  • Get the bird scraped and diagnosed properly rather than guessing from appearance alone, since a couple of other skin conditions can look superficially similar at a glance
  • House the affected conure apart from its usual cage-mate until treatment has run its full course
  • See the prescribed anti-parasitic regimen through to its actual end date, not just until the crust visibly softens
  • Have the vet look specifically at beak symmetry if the crusting had clearly been present for a while before anyone noticed
  • Describe this bird's housing setup — solo, paired, or aviary — accurately to the vet, since that shapes how far the investigation needs to extend

Pyrrhura molinae, the wild ancestor of the pet green-cheeked conure, comes from the humid lowland forests of Bolivia, Paraguay, and neighboring Brazil and Argentina — a habitat quite different from the arid Australian scrubland budgerigars evolved in, and one reason Knemidokoptes mange is documented less frequently in this species even though the same genus of mite is fully capable of infecting it.

The mite itself burrows into the outer skin layer rather than crawling on the surface, and the immune system normally keeps a small resident population from ever amounting to anything visible; a case only becomes a honeycomb-textured, crusted patch once something else — age, an unrelated illness, or a run of poor condition — lets that balance tip.

A green-cheek's famously mellow, unflappable disposition cuts both ways here: it makes this an easy bird to examine calmly, but it also means an early, small patch of crusting is easy for an owner to miss simply because the bird isn't acting distressed or drawing attention to the spot the way a more reactive species might.

Delay carries a real structural cost. A mange case left to run its course for months can warp the keratin the beak is built from, and once that warping sets in, it tends to persist as a lasting shape change even after the mite population itself has been fully cleared by treatment.

The fix is a prescription anti-parasitic aimed specifically at this burrowing mite — an over-the-counter surface spray is built for a different kind of parasite and simply won't penetrate deep enough to reach it — and the prescribed schedule has to run its full length, since the mite's egg-to-adult cycle means a treatment stopped right after the crust looks better can still leave survivors behind.

Nutrition plays a background role worth naming honestly rather than overselling: a conure eating a genuinely varied, pellet-anchored diet tends to weather exposure to this mite better than one on a repetitive, nutrient-thin one, though diet alone won't prevent a case in a bird that's otherwise run down by illness or age.

Because green-cheeks are commonly kept in bonded same-species pairs or small same-species trios rather than singly, a confirmed diagnosis in one bird is reasonable grounds to have its cage-mate examined too, even without visible crusting yet — direct skin contact between paired birds is exactly the kind of exposure this mite spreads through.

A case that resurfaces weeks after what looked like a clean course is more often explained by an unaddressed stressor than by the mite developing drug resistance, which stays uncommon — worth raising with the vet as a question about the bird's broader condition rather than assuming the medication simply didn't work.

Distinguishing a mite-driven crust from ordinary variation in cere color and texture matters, since males and females of this species can look somewhat different at the cere even when both are perfectly healthy — a scrape settles the question far more reliably than eyeballing it.

A conure with an already-compromised immune system from an unrelated condition is more likely to let a background mite population turn symptomatic, which is one reason an unexplained mange flare-up in an otherwise well-cared-for bird is worth treating as a cue to look at the animal's overall health picture, not just the visible skin.

Preventing this long-term

A stable, low-stress routine — consistent cage placement, a predictable daily schedule — keeps the immune system positioned to suppress a background mite population before it ever turns visible.

Working a quick look at the beak, cere, and feet into the same handling session used for nail or wing checks catches a developing patch long before it distorts anything.

Isolating any newly acquired conure from an existing bird for a real quarantine window, rather than a token day or two, keeps an unknown mite status from becoming a shared one.

Choosing a breeder or rescue willing to discuss a specific bird's health background lowers the odds of bringing this parasite home in the first place.

A varied, pellet-anchored diet with fresh produce gives the immune system more to work with against this and other opportunistic parasites.

Routine annual exams build a baseline a vet can compare against, which matters for a species whose calm temperament otherwise hides early symptoms well.

Examining a bonded cage-mate the moment the other bird of the pair tests positive, rather than waiting for its own symptoms, catches the second case at its earliest and easiest stage.

Revisiting what changed in a bird's routine or health status before a first flare-up, instead of treating the mite in isolation, helps prevent the same conditions from recreating a second outbreak.

When to see a vet

Any patch of the tell-tale pitted, honeycomb-textured crust on the beak, cere, or feet is worth a scrape-confirmed diagnosis from an avian vet within the week — this species presents the same way budgerigars do, just less frequently.
